BTRFS can handle zoned disks. The doc claims that it was a natural fit with the way BTRFS works.

The problem is that you cannot buy host managed zoned disks.




WD was pushing for this standard a few years back: https://www.westerndigital.com/company/innovation/zoned-stor... I'm not sure what happened to it / whether it was successful or not.


I think they also sold HA-SMR (host aware SMR, a mix of drive managed and host managed) drives to datacenters but I couldn't find any recent news so I guess those aren't that common.
